Can this Cattleya with dried roots be saved?
Default Can this Cattleya with dried roots be saved?

Hoping to get advice about how to save a Cattleya I just bought. I bought the Cattleya about a week ago at an orchid sale, and it's labeled as a "SLC Circle of Life." This is my first Cattleya, and all my other orchids are Phals.

It was in a plastic container with holes, but I couldn't see the roots at the time of purchase. I took the orchid out of the pot today to check it's root health and discovered nearly all of the roots are dried out! Most are white, but a few are brown. The brown ones do not feel mushy, but instead feel dried out and hollow. There were 1 or 2 roots that had a bit of a green hue. The photos are of the plant after I water it, so hopefully the green-ish roots are visible.

I'm not sure if it's possible to save this orchid, and would appreciate any advice!
